    Kenworth trucks fitted with air tanks holding insufficient brake air

    PACCAR is recalling certain 2009-2024 Kenworth trucks because the air tanks have an insufficient volume of air for the brake system, which can reduce braking performance.

    PACCAR Recalls Kenworth and Peterbilt Trucks for Steering Fastener Defect

    PACCAR is recalling 2018-2020 Kenworth and Peterbilt trucks because steering arm fasteners may fail, potentially causing loss of steering control.

    PACCAR recalls Peterbilt and Kenworth trucks for brake system defect

    PACCAR is recalling approximately 908 Peterbilt and Kenworth commercial trucks from 2019-2022 for a brake defect that may cause unintended vehicle movement during winching operations. Software updates will be provided free of charge.

    PACCAR Recalls 2020 Kenworth and Peterbilt Trucks for Axle Shaft Defect

    PACCAR is recalling 2020 Kenworth and Peterbilt trucks because improperly heat-treated rear axle output shafts may fracture, creating a road hazard.

    Kenworth Trucks Recalled for Potential Rear Axle Oil Deficiency

    PACCAR is recalling 2020 Kenworth T680, T800, T880, W900, and W990 trucks because rear axles may lack oil, increasing crash risk.

    Kenworth and Peterbilt Commercial Trucks Recalled for Methane Detection System Failure

    PACCAR is recalling approximately 1,107 Kenworth and Peterbilt commercial trucks (2016–2022) due to methane detection system power loss. If the system loses electrical power, operators may not detect dangerous methane levels, increasing fire and injury risk.

    Heavy-duty trucks recalled for fuel rail defect and fire risk

    PACCAR is recalling certain 2018-2021 Kenworth and Peterbilt commercial trucks because a sealing washer defect in the fuel rail assembly may cause fuel leaks. When fuel leaks occur near an ignition source, fire risk increases.

    Kenworth and Peterbilt trucks recalled for suspension bolt defects

    PACCAR is recalling approximately 1,097 certain 2020-2021 Kenworth and Peterbilt heavy trucks with Watson and Chalin steerable lift axle suspension systems. The pivot bolts may be too short to properly engage the locking nuts, risking separation from the suspension and potential vehicle crashes.

    PACCAR Recalls Peterbilt and Kenworth Trucks Due to ABS Warning Light Defect

    PACCAR is recalling specific Peterbilt and Kenworth trucks because the ABS warning light may fail to illuminate if power is lost, increasing crash risk.

    Kenworth T680 and T880 Recalled for Parking Brake Signal Delay

    PACCAR is recalling 2018-2020 Kenworth T680 and T880 trucks because a parking brake signal delay in cold weather may cause unexpected vehicle movement.
